federal agency: In its recent Q2 house price analysis, the federal agency warned that Toronto, Regina and Winnipeg are at high risk of a housing correction, according to The Chronicle Herald. Banks: Canada big banks report their third-quarter earnings throughout the week, starting with the Bank of Montreal on Tuesday and ending with Scotiabank on Friday. Housing: The Canada Mortgage and Housing Corp. releases its 2015 second-quarter financial report on Monday. The ongoing oil price plummet and a spate of bleak economic indicators in the first half of the year have sparked renewed concerns about the health of the banks. Stats Can: The federal agency has an array of releases this week, including one on Wednesday about economic immigrants and another on Thursday on statistics for enterprises. Housing: Bank of Canada deputy governor Lawrence Schembri is in Kingston, Ont., on Tuesday to give a speech about the international perspective on the long-term evolution of house prices.
